}This guide provides a complete, production-ready implementation of a multi-provider AI chatbot with:
- 5 AI Provider Fallback Chain: Gemini → OpenRouter → Groq → Hugging Face → OpenAI
- Robust Message Normalization: 5 layers ensuring string format (handles array/object formats)
- RAG (Retrieval Augmented Generation): FAQ-based context retrieval
- Session Management: Redis-based chat history with normalization
- Streaming Support: Real-time response streaming
- Fast Rate Limit Handling: Skips remaining models immediately on 429 errors
- Deep Validation: Prevents mutation and ensures type safety
- Type-Safe: Full TypeScript implementation
User Message
↓
Gemini (Primary) → Rate Limited? → Skip remaining Gemini models immediately
↓
OpenRouter (Fallback 1) → Failed? → Try next
↓
Groq (Fallback 2) → Failed? → Try next
↓
Hugging Face (Fallback 3) → Try 20+ models → Failed? → Try next
↓
OpenAI Direct (Fallback 4) → Final backup
↓
Response to User┌─────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┐

function cosineSimilarity(a: number[], b: number[]): number {
if (a.length !== b.length) return 0;
let dotProduct = 0;
let normA = 0;
let normB = 0;
for (let i = 0; i < a.length; i++) {
dotProduct += a[i] * b[i];
normA += a[i] * a[i];
normB += b[i] * b[i];
}
return dotProduct / (Math.sqrt(normA) * Math.sqrt(normB));
}import { NextRequest } from "next/server";

SESSION_TTL=604800 # 7 days in secondsWhy it's critical:
- AI APIs expect string content, not arrays or objects
- Redis may store messages in different formats
- Prevents runtime errors and API failures
Implementation layers:
- Redis retrieval (
lib/redis.ts): Normalize when loading from Redis - Initial processing (
lib/ai.ts): Normalize all incoming messages - Double-check: Verify all messages are strings
- Runtime validation: Final check before sending to APIs (especially OpenRouter)
Why it's important:
- Reduces wait time when Gemini is rate-limited
- Immediately tries fallback providers
- Better user experience
Implementation:
if (errorMessage.includes("429") || errorMessage.includes("quota")) {
geminiRateLimited = true;
break; // Skip remaining Gemini models immediately
}Why it's needed:
- OpenRouter uses Chat Completions API which requires strict string format
- Prevents
invalid_unionerrors - Ensures message content is never mutated
Implementation:
const validatedMessages = aiMessages.map((msg) => {
const clonedMsg = JSON.parse(JSON.stringify(msg)); // Deep clone
// Ensure string content
// Final check
return { role, content: String(clonedMsg.content) };
});Why multiple models:
- Some models may be unavailable (410 Gone)
- Different models have different speeds
- Ensures reliability
Implementation:
- Try smaller models first (faster)
- Fall back to larger models if needed
- Continue to next provider if all fail
